About

Meifang Lu is a scholar working on Molecular Biology, Biotechnology and Genetics. According to data from OpenAlex, Meifang Lu has authored 20 papers receiving a total of 471 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 8 papers in Biotechnology and 4 papers in Genetics. Recurrent topics in Meifang Lu's work include Transgenic Plants and Applications (4 papers), Biopolymer Synthesis and Applications (4 papers) and CRISPR and Genetic Engineering (3 papers). Meifang Lu is often cited by papers focused on Transgenic Plants and Applications (4 papers), Biopolymer Synthesis and Applications (4 papers) and CRISPR and Genetic Engineering (3 papers). Meifang Lu collaborates with scholars based in China. Meifang Lu's co-authors include Chunling Wang, Xiaohong Cao, Wenyan Yang, Zhenyu Liao, Xiaohong Cao, Aihua Wang, Lihua Hou, Bin Zeng, Guowei Huang and Ping Cai and has published in prestigious journals such as Journal of the Science of Food and Agriculture, Chemico-Biological Interactions and Journal of Cereal Science.
